Comments
Comments: Trails were all dry. Brook Trail is much more heavily traveled as compared to a few years ago. The BRATTS have done excellent work on the very bottom and very top of the trail, making it more sustainable and nicer walking.

Many of the ski trails are mowed, and there are some nice unofficial mountain bike paths winding down them with good footing.

Cloudy, seasonably warm afternoon. Foliage is still mostly green, but there are some excellent colors in places.
